What Are Hurricane Clips?

Hurricane clips are metal fasteners that attach roof trusses to the walls of a home, providing additional reinforcement against strong wind gusts during a storm. They help keep roofs from blowing off or collapsing due to heavy winds, which can cause major structural damage and even death if not properly secured. In addition to protecting your home from wind damage, hurricane clips also reduce the chances of water entering through gaps between roof trusses and walls during heavy rains associated with hurricanes. This helps protect both your property and your family from potential flooding or water damage caused by high winds and rain.

The Importance of Hurricane Clips

Hurricane clips are metal fasteners used at each rafter or truss where it meets an exterior wall, creating a stronger connection than traditional methods such as toe nailing or wood blocking. This helps prevent uplift forces from tearing off the roof during high winds or other storm events. Hurricane clips also increase overall structural strength by transferring load from one side of the wall to another when wind pressures push against one side more than another.
